Benefits of Advanced Cataract Surgery



When thinking about advanced cataract surgery, you can anticipate improved vision and faster recovery times contrasted to conventional techniques. Advanced cataract surgical procedure methods, such as laser-assisted treatments, supply greater precision in removing the over cast lens and replacing it with a clear artificial lens. This accuracy results in much better aesthetic end results, with many clients experiencing substantially sharper vision post-surgery. In addition, advanced cataract surgical procedure commonly leads to faster recovery times, allowing you to resume your daily activities faster.

One more benefit of advanced cataract surgical procedure is lowered dependence on glasses or call lenses after the treatment. With innovations in intraocular lens modern technology, specialists can currently provide lens implants that correct not only cataracts but additionally various other refractive mistakes like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. This implies that you may achieve more clear vision at numerous distances without the requirement for restorative eyewear.

Client Viability and Eligibility



To establish if you appropriate for sophisticated cataract surgical procedure, your eye surgeon will certainly evaluate numerous aspects consisting of the wellness of your eyes and overall case history. Factors such as the seriousness of your cataracts, the visibility of various other eye conditions like glaucoma or macular degeneration, and the overall wellness of your eyes will certainly all be taken into consideration. Additionally, your surgeon will certainly examine your basic health condition, including any kind of clinical problems you may have and medicines you're taking.

It is important to communicate freely with your eye surgeon about any type of existing health issues, previous eye surgeries, or medicines you're currently utilizing. Your doctor will certainly likewise consider your expectations and way of living when determining if progressed cataract surgical treatment is the best choice for you. By offering detailed information and discussing your goals for the treatment, you and your doctor can interact to determine if you're an appropriate candidate for advanced cataract surgical procedure.
